Senior Embedded Software Engineer (Goleta) Job at Softworld, a Kelly Company, Goleta, CA

dE0wWWVRdUhhSzVsQXNwK28wYVZlQk9pQUE9PQ==
  • Softworld, a Kelly Company
  • Goleta, CA

Job Description

Job Title : Senior Embedded Software Engineer

Job Location : Goleta California 93117



Onsite Requirements :

  • Embedded Software (C/C++)
  • Bachelor's Degree
  • Minimum 5 years of engineering experience

Job Description:

Job Responsibilities:

  • Apply fundamental knowledge of software engineering principles and core concepts (e.g., data structures, algorithms, computer architecture, operating systems, and databases) to create software solutions that meet project-based needs
  • Apply core computer science concepts in the development, testing, and documentation of software units
  • Review customer specifications and requirements, and develop designs to best support them
  • Develop, document and support testing of products, systems or subsystems
  • Participates as a member of the testing team to plan and review test cases within software solution components
  • Provide budget, cost and schedule input for design assignments
  • Document component and subsystem specifications
  • Specify and evaluate supplier subsystems and services
  • Participates in code reviews with the systems engineers, software architects, and other technical staff
  • Collaborate with internal and external customers to develop systems to meet required business specifications
  • Ability to complete a technical project independently and manage other engineers
  • Support, communicate, reinforce and defend the mission, values and culture of the organization
  • Attend appropriate engineering, customer or business meetings
  • Lead less-experienced engineers

Qualifications:

  • Bachelor's degree in Computer Science, Computer Engineering or related field
  • 5+ years of industry experience in delivering high-quality, innovative applications and programming experience in one or more of the following: C, C++, C# and/or Java
  • Ability to obtain and maintain a US government security clearance
  • Proven Computer Science fundamentals in algorithm design, problem solving, and complexity analysis
  • Experience with Linux/Unix and/or Windows
  • Experience with software version control systems (preferably GIT)
  • Practical experience working with embedded software
  • Experience in Object Oriented design and development
  • Ability to write detailed design documents incorporating UML techniques
  • Experience following formal software development processes
  • Excellent verbal and written communication skills
  • Detail-oriented, organized, and able to work well in a team environment as well as independently with little day-to-day guidance
  • Demonstrates an ambition to learn
  • Willing to travel up to 10% as necessary

  • **3rd party and subcontract staffing agencies are not eligible for partnership on this position. 3rd party subcontractors need not apply.
  • This position requires candidates to be eligible to work in the United States, directly for an employer, without sponsorship now or anytime in the future.
  • This client is a US Federal Government contractor and is legally required to hire US Citizens. US Citizens will only be considered for this role**

Job Tags

For contractors, For subcontractor,

Similar Jobs

Intuit

Senior Tax Consultant - Work from Home - 2+ Yrs Paid Tax Experience Required​ Job at Intuit

 ...discounts and free copy of TurboTax Live.As part of this position, you have the opportunity to work 100% remotely, collaborating with an exceptional team from the comfort of your home or office. What you'll bringWho You Are:As a Tax Expert, you have a minimum of 2 years of... 

J.B. Hunt Transport

CDL-A Local Truck Driver Job at J.B. Hunt Transport

 ...Hunt Transport CDL-A Local Truck Driver Hiring CDL-A truck drivers for a local driving job! Daily home time, consecutive days off, multiple shift options and more. Medical benefits after 30 days of employment, company-matched 401(k) and PTO accrual starts on your first... 

The Knowledge Exchange Inc

Volunteer Board member Job at The Knowledge Exchange Inc

 ...---------TKE is seeking 2 community volunteers to serve on our Board of Directors. This role supports the organizations mission, vision...  ...Financial developmentProgram/Project developmentThe Board Members Primary Responsibilities:Attend and actively participate in board... 

Centria Autism

Center - Based Behavior Technician - Entry Level Job at Centria Autism

We are looking for enthusiastic individuals to join our team as Behavior Technicians. As a Behavior Technician, you will have the opportunity to make a real difference in the lives of children with autism. In this role, you will work one-on-one with children, implementing...

LegalZoom

Content Designer Job at LegalZoom

 ...Content Designer LegalZoom is on a mission to help people navigate the legal system with confidence and clarity. As a leader in online legal services for over 20 years, we combine technology, attorney-led solutions, and expertise to protect the aspirations, lives,...